The Allen-Bradley 1734-OE2C/B is a 2-channel analog output module engineered as part of Rockwell Automation’s POINT I/O platform — a modular, high-density I/O architecture purpose-built for demanding industrial control environments. Designed to deliver precise, stable analog signal output under conditions of elevated temperature, high humidity, mechanical vibration, airborne particulates, and electromagnetic interference, the 1734-OE2C/B is a mission-critical component for engineers and procurement specialists who cannot afford signal drift or module failure on the production floor.
Operating within a wide ambient temperature range and rated for continuous-duty industrial cycles, this module outputs 0–20 mA or 4–20 mA current signals — or ±10 V voltage signals — with 12-bit resolution, ensuring the fine-grained control accuracy required in process control loops, valve positioners, variable frequency drives, and proportional actuator systems. Its compact POINT I/O form factor allows dense mounting on DIN rail within control cabinets, minimizing footprint while maximizing channel density in space-constrained enclosures.

The 1734-OE2C/B does not operate in isolation — it is one node in a tightly integrated control architecture. In a typical POINT I/O rack, it works alongside the 1734-IB8 8-channel digital input module and the 1734-OB8 digital output module to form a complete mixed I/O station. The rack is managed by an adapter such as the 1734-AENT EtherNet/IP adapter, which bridges the POINT I/O backplane to the plant-level Ethernet network and allows the 1756-L73 ControlLogix processor to read and write analog values in real time.
On the power side, the 1734-EP24DC POINT I/O power supply module provides stable 24 VDC bus power to the I/O rail, ensuring that analog output accuracy is not compromised by voltage fluctuation — a critical consideration in environments where heavy motor loads or variable frequency drives such as the PowerFlex 525 or PowerFlex 755 introduce transient voltage events on the supply rail. Surge protection and proper grounding of the control cabinet further protect the analog output channels from EMI-induced signal corruption.
For safety-rated applications, the 1734-OE2C/B is often deployed alongside safety I/O modules such as the 1734-IB8S safety digital input module and the 1734-OB8S safety digital output module, both part of the POINT Guard I/O family. These safety modules share the same DIN rail and cabinet space, allowing engineers to build a compact, mixed standard-and-safety I/O station without requiring a separate safety PLC enclosure.
Communication integrity is maintained through the 1734-ACNR ControlNet adapter or the 1734-ADN DeviceNet adapter, depending on the plant’s network topology. In legacy installations where DeviceNet is the primary fieldbus, the 1734-OE2C/B continues to deliver reliable analog output performance, making it a versatile replacement part across multiple generations of Rockwell Automation control systems.
Terminal wiring is simplified using compatible 1734-RTB removable terminal blocks, which allow module replacement without disturbing field wiring — a significant advantage during emergency maintenance windows on continuous production lines where downtime is measured in thousands of dollars per minute.

Q3: Is the 1734-OE2C/B compatible with my existing POINT I/O rack and ControlLogix system?
Yes. The 1734-OE2C/B is fully compatible with all standard POINT I/O adapters including the 1734-AENT, 1734-ACNR, and 1734-ADN. It integrates with ControlLogix, CompactLogix, and SoftLogix controllers via the standard POINT I/O module profile in Studio 5000 Logix Designer. Series B designation indicates a hardware revision with improved noise immunity — it is backward compatible with Series A installations in most configurations. Buyers are advised to verify the EDS file version in their controller project matches the installed module series.
